    9 Before using the hot plates f or the first time, you should heat them at maxim um temperature for appr oximatel y 4 minutes, without an y pans. During this initial stage, their protective coating hardens and reaches its maximum resistance. The green pilot lamp (H) This lights up when an electric plate is tur ned on.     13 The catalytic self-c leaning system Some models ha ve o ven liners coated with a porous enamel also known as catal ytic enamel. When hot, this enamel destro ys all greasy f ood par ticles. F or this "oxidation" to occur , the oven liners m ust reach a temperature of at least 170°C. The porosity of the catalytic enamel increases its su ...
